6th Grade Science

Inquiry skills, safety, and the Scientific method

TermDefinition
Independent variable Factor that you change to see it's effect
Dependent variable The factor being measured
Draw conclusion States whether or not the data supports your hypothesis
Observing Using your five senses to explore the physical properties and behaviors of things in the world
Classifying Sorting and grouping things by one or more physical properties or behaviors
Inferring Taking your observations and reflecting on them using information you have learned from your previous experiences
Predicting Making an educated guess to explain why, how, or when something happens
Making a hypothesis A scientific explanation that you think is true and can be tested
Communicating Telling what you know by writing, speaking, drawing, graphing, or demonstrating
Measuring Using a calibrated science tool to quantify a physical property and find out how much of it you have
Interpreting data The ability to look at data and understand the trends, patterns, and relationships shown in graphs, charts, and notes
Experimenting Testing a hypothesis using the scientific method
